Your iP is: 216.73.216.42 United States Near: United States

IP Lookup Details:

IP Information - 140.75.165.78

Host name: 140.75.165.78

Country: China

Country Code: CN

Region: Shandong

City: Qingdao

Latitude: 36.0649

Longitude: 120.3804

Expand section Whois information
Rosamunde Pilcher

The IP was involved in a Caller ID Spoofing attack, falsifying the caller ID to deceive the receiver or hide the caller's identity.

Reported on: 23rd, Oct. 2024
Complaint Form